  • In this paper, we consider feedback-linearizing control of VR (Variable Reluctance) motors which have been increasingly used in high performance direct-drive applications. We characterize all torque controllers that can make the generated torque of a VR motor linear to torque command but without torque ripple. The torque controlles maximize the range of torque commands which are admissible under the physical limitation in stator currents. The whole class of all such torque controllers is parameterized in the explicit form which contains a function to be chosen freely. This free function can be used to achieve other control objectives as well as linear dynamic characteristics. As the examples for optimal choices of the free function, we actually determine two optimal free functions, one for minimal rate of change in current commands and the other for minimal power loss due to stator resistance. To illuminate further the practical use of torque controllers proposed in this paper, we present some experimental results for the case of a commercially available VR motor.

  • Kinematic and dynamic characteristics of a Stewart platform based parallel manipulators are fixed once they are constructed. Thus parallel manipulators with various configurations are required to meet a variety of applications. In this research a parallel manipulator with variable platform (PMVP) has been developed, in which the length of the arm linking the platform center to the platform-leg contact point can be varied by an actuator. The workspace of the PMVP is larger than that of a traditional Stewart platform and especially the range in which the maximum orientation angles can be maintained is significantly expanded. Furthermore, the characteristics of force and moment transmission between the legs and platform can be adjusted to meet the requirements of various tasks. Kinematic and dynamics analysis was performed to verify the usefulness of the PMVP and the actual hardware was built to demonstrate the feasibility.

  • Continuously variable transmission (CVT) mechanisms combine the functions of a K-H-V type differential gear unit and a V-belt type continuously variable unit (CVU). For the 24 different mechanisms, 12 of them are power circulation modes while the other 12 are power split modes. Some useful theoretical formulas related to speed ratio, power flow and efficiency were derived and analyzed. These mechanisms have many advantages: they decrease CVT size and weight, increase overall efficiency, extend speed ratio range, and generate geared neutral. Compound CVTs were developed by combining the power circulation mode and power split mode, which can offer backward motion, geared neutral, underdrive and overdrive.

  • In this paper, an efficient architecture of a versatile Reed-Solomon (RS) decoder is designed, where the message length k as well as the block length n can be variable. The decoder permits 3-step pipelined processing based on the modified Euclid's algorithm(MEA). A new architecture for the MEA is designed for variable values of error correcting capability t. To maintain the throughput rate with less circuitry, the MEA block uses both the recursive and the overclocking technique. The decoder can decode a codeword received not only in a burst mode, but also in a continuous mode. It can be used in a wide range of applications due to its versatility. A versatile RS decoder over GF(2$^{8}$ ) having the error-correcting capability of up to 10 has been designed in VHDL, and successfully synthesized in an FPGA chip.

  • Continuously variable transmission(CVT) mechanisms considered here combine the functions of a 2K-H I type differential gear unit and a V-belt continuously variable unit(CVU). One shaft of the V-belt CVU is connected directly to the differential gear unit and remaining shaft of it is linked to the output shaft. These mechanisms have many advantage which are the decrease of CVT size, the increase of overall efficiency, the extension of speed ratio range, and the generation of geared neutral. In this paper six different mechanisms of output coupled type CVT are proposed. Some useful theoretical formula related to speed ratio, power flow and efficiency are derived and analyzed, and theoretical analysis are proven by various experiments.
